Welcome to Dissertating and Drinks!
This is our first episode; a little bit about us, the podcast and lots of laughter!
The idea behind Dissertating and Drinks was birthed while writing our own dissertation proposals at a local coffee shop. Within this podcast we hope to reflect on navigating academia and professional spaces, while also reflecting on our dissertation work processes, our experiences, and hear from amazing guests. This process can be isolating and overwhelming and we're hoping that this podcast helps others who are in this process find validation, support, and joy in hearing from others who can relate!
